Output a23ebab588bad36c6b5d00d4ee1dacb72a3c4a132b4dc79aa574f97be3bd0517:3

value
80990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aae63bf587b694b2221b9e7c4aa06e42f158d62 OP_EQUALVERIFY OP_CHECKSIG
address
17osuzzqkYkThnDCDcYvxTzvr5WJfYuVE5
transaction
a23ebab588bad36c6b5d00d4ee1dacb72a3c4a132b4dc79aa574f97be3bd0517
confirmations
518402
spent
true